The Yale Junior Bulldogs are a youth hockey organization based in New Haven, Connecticut, and are affiliated with Yale University. The program is designed for young hockey players, providing them with the opportunity to develop their skills and compete at a high level. The Junior Bulldogs offer a range of teams for different age groups, from mini-mites to bantams, and are committed to helping players improve their game while also promoting sportsmanship, teamwork, and a love of the sport.

Teams and Age Groups

The Yale Junior Bulldogs offer teams for the following age groups: mini-mites (ages 5-6), mites (ages 7-8), squirts (ages 9-10), peewees (ages 11-12), and bantams (ages 13-14). Each team is led by a experienced coach who is dedicated to helping players develop their skills and reach their full potential. The Junior Bulldogs also offer a range of programs and clinics for players of all ages and skill levels, including goalie clinics, skating clinics, and hockey camps.
